BVRLA membership at ten year high

23 July 2015

The BVRLA has welcomed 73 new members across all its categories of membership during the first six months of 2015.

The BVRLA’s total membership has exceeded 750, which is a ten-year high. The association has welcomed 73 new members across all categories of membership during the first half of 2015.

The growth has been partly attributed to the strengthening economy and also the rising popularity of vehicle leasing and rental; it is also a reflection of the role that BVRLA plays to enable members to achieve and maintain compliance in an increasingly regulated industry.

The BVRLA has been working closely over the last 18 months with the Competition and Markets Authority in its review of the car rental sector, as well as the Financial Conduct Authority in its development of a consumer credit regime.

In addition, the association’s Conciliation Service has recently become one of the first alternative dispute resolution services to be approved by the Trading Standards Institute in the UK.

BVRLA Chief Executive, Gerry Keaney, said;

“We are delighted to welcome all these members into the association and look forward to working with them in the future.

“They have chosen to be part of a vibrant, collaborative trade body that promotes best practice and campaigns on behalf of the industry and its customers. We know they will wear the logo with pride.”
